Canatu secures additional CNT reactor order from FST for EUV pellicle production

Canatu has secured an additional CNT100 SEMI reactor order from FST for CNT-based EUV pellicle production. The contract exceeds EUR 5 million including earlier long-lead items. The order follows prior reactor qualification and licensing, supporting further scale-up of Canatu’s CNT technology.

Cnano will sell 51% of C-Nano Technology to Aether Materials for USD25.5 million as part of a phased restructuring of its US CNT business. The move aims to meet US Non-PFE ownership rules and preserve customers’ eligibility for clean-energy manufacturing tax credits.
